Both The University of Findlay and Walsh are private. Both schools are located in Ohio.
  • The University of Findlay Graduate School has more expensive graduate school tuition of $18,456 than Walsh Graduate School ($13,510).
  • The University of Findlay Graduate School is larger with 1,074 graduate students than Walsh Graduate School (751 students).
  • The University of Findlay Graduate School has more graduate programs of 110 programs than Walsh Graduate School (76 programs).
